On Sunday November 21, 2009, The World Wrestling Association (WWA), Punchout Promotions, and LaUnion1910 will be producing “Vive La Lucha” Arts and Cultural Festival, a revolutionary collaboration of live Mexican style wrestling (Lucha Libre), music entertainment, and art exhibitions from numerous Latino artists. A diverse musical line-up, delicious food, art exhibition, topped by the very best of Mexican style wrestling make for the perfect day of entertainment.
